Ballantyne Auditorium is Kirkwood’s 375-seat Performing Arts facility and home to the talented students involved in Music and Theatre.
Ballantyne Auditorium is located at 6301 Kirkwood Blvd. SW in Cedar Rapids. Use the south campus entrance and follow the signs to Ballantyne Auditorium. An accessible elevator is available to the left of the staircase that leads down to the auditorium.

Exhibit: Mission Heliographique Revisite 2024: In the footsteps of the French photographic practitioners of 1851
March 4 to April 12
This exhibition revisits the architecture, monuments, and landscapes that comprised the notion of French National Identity with photographs by Christine Flavin, Assistant Professor of Photography at Kirkwood, and photographic placques by Kelly Koppel.
Christine received her BA from the University of California, Berkeley, and her MFA from the University of Iowa.
